F.N.B. Co. (NYSE:FNB) Shares Sold by JFS Wealth Advisors LLC

JFS Wealth Advisors LLC reduced its stake in shares of F.N.B. Co. (NYSE:FNBFree Report) by 8.7%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 51,885 shares of the bank’s stock after selling 4,967 shares during the quarter. JFS Wealth Advisors LLC’s holdings in F.N.B. were worth $767,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

F.N.B. Corporation, a bank and financial holding company, provides a range of financial products and services primarily to consumers, corporations, governments, and small- to medium-sized businesses in the United States. The company operates through three segments: Community Banking, Wealth Management, and Insurance.
